The Ancient and Accepted Rite for England and Wales covers the 4th-33rd degrees, including the 18th 'Rose Croix' degree. The author explores the historic background to this important part of Freemasonry with the original being published in 1980. A second edition appeared in 1987 which was a completely revised work after much new documented evidence was discovered, and this third edition is another reprint of this authoritative study.

The Ancient and Mystical Order of the Rose-Cross is a philosophical organization that perpetuates the teachings that the initiates have transmitted one to another through the centuries since the highest antiquity. Along with these teachings, it conveys a certain ethic based on the awakening of the virtues inherent in the human soul. Of these virtues, twelve have taken the attention of the grand master of the order, author of this book. Thus, he explains chapter in chapter in which patience, confidence, temperance, tolerance, detachment, selflessness, integrity, humility, courage, nonviolence, benevolence, and wisdom are qualities that every human being must acquire in the course of his existence not only because they justify our spiritual evolution but also because they contribute to the happiness of others.

No Scottish Rite Mason can truly claim his title without an understanding of the philosophy, religious examinations and ethics as offered in the degrees the Chapter Rose Croix. This classic study by Albert Pike, taken from his Morals and Dogma, along with the historical background by Albert Mackey makes this work required reading for all sincere Scottish Rite Masons.
